Your new role

The MARAM Coordinator role has been established to deliver a streamlined, systemic approach to sector development and support. As the MARAM Coordinator, you will lead the development, coordination, implementation and evaluation of assigned activities under the MARAM Collaborative Practice Training (MCPT) workplan.

In this role, some of your other responsibilities will include:

  • Supporting the delivery of the MARAM Sector Support Project (SSP) workplan, the Annual Action Plan, and priority projects under the CHIFVC Strategic Plan (2026-29), as required. 
  • The delivery of a bespoke MARAM Collaborative Practice Training model for the Central Highlands Area.
  • Leading the delivery of MARAM Collaborative Practice Training for local agencies and support the delivery of MARAM alignment across the region.
  • Collaborating with local agencies delivering primary prevention activities, to ensure they have access to MARAM-aligned training and sector development support.

Your skills and experience
  • Relevant tertiary qualification in social work, community services, public policy, health or a related field
  • Demonstrated knowledge of, and experience working within, the family violence sector
  • Experience delivering MARAM or related family violence training (desirable)
  • Knowledge of regional service systems and cross-sector collaboration (desirable)
  • Ability to scope, plan and implement projects within required timeframes
